Danny MacAskills latest video: Imaginate.

Making it (and words?) up as he goes along. A great trials vid, with other cools one too on this link.

Two years in the making, street trials rider Danny MacAskill releases his brand new riding film. Whilst previous projects have focused on locations and and journey's, MacAskill's Imaginate sees Danny take a completely different approach to riding. Enter Danny's mind and enjoy.

Some fantastic Irish results today:

Mark Rohan took gold in TT at Paracycling World Cup in Segovia.
Anne Dalton and Katie Dunleavy scored a bronze in the tandem event.
Philip Deignan came 4th in the Tour de Beuace TT.
Dan Martin came 6th on a mountainous stage 7 of the Tour de Suisse.
